About the Event

Tacoma Refugee Choir will be singing at this World Refugee Day event organized by refugees.

World Refugee Day is an international day organized every year on 20 June by the United Nations. It is designed to celebrate and honor refugees from around the world. The day was first established on 20 June 2001, in recognition of the 50th anniversary of the 1951 Convention Relating to the Status of Refugees. Building upon refugee resilience and their contribution in the development of the US, Refugee Congress in partnership with the KCLS and other partners in Washington State, organized the 2022 World Refugee Day event which will feature refugee and immigrant performances including the Tacoma Refugee Choir, West African Dance, Poetry, music and more. The event is centered in bringing refugees, immigrants, and the refugee services providers together. Attendees will have the opportunity to connect with their fellows, test the amazing food prepared by refugee owned restaurants representing food from across the world. Additional activities will include about 10 different refugee led organizatios showcasing their services. FREE
